Practice areas

Our Expertise

What we do

  • Test Management

Effective test management is crucial for coordinating testing activities, setting clear priorities, and maintaining quality. Without it, projects can face delays, miscommunication, and missed deadlines.

With extensive experience in managing end-to-end testing, including system integration and acceptance testing, we ensure seamless collaboration and structured execution. Our approach minimizes risks and delivers results aligned with your objectives.

By focusing on clarity and organization, we streamline the testing process, helping your projects stay on track and achieve consistent quality.

  • Agile Testing

Agile testing integrates testing into development cycles, enabling teams to deliver reliable software quickly and efficiently. Without it, issues can go undetected, disrupting progress.

We have experience embedding testing into Agile workflows, catching issues early and supporting continuous delivery. In larger-scale frameworks, we enhance collaboration and adaptability to meet complex requirements.

By aligning testing with Agile methodologies, we help teams work faster and smarter, ensuring quality is embedded at every stage.

  • Quality Engineering

Optimizing tools and processes is essential for driving efficiency and maintaining consistent quality. Without it, testing efforts can become time-consuming and less effective.

We focus on improving workflows and introducing smarter tools to enhance scalability and reliability in testing. These improvements streamline operations and ensure robust outcomes.

Our expertise in quality engineering ensures your testing processes are efficient, scalable, and tailored to meet your unique challenges.

  • System Validation

System validation ensures that integrated systems meet requirements and work seamlessly together. Without it, errors and inconsistencies can lead to operational disruptions and reduced trust.

Through comprehensive end-to-end testing, we validate systems to ensure they perform as intended and deliver a cohesive user experience. Our approach minimizes risks and enhances reliability.

We focus on thorough validation to ensure your systems deliver consistent, dependable performance under all conditions.

  • Test Automation

Test automation enhances efficiency, reduces manual effort, and ensures consistency in testing cycles. Without it, repetitive tasks can slow progress and strain resources.

We maintain and optimize automation frameworks to align them with project goals, ensuring faster and more reliable testing. These frameworks support seamless integration into your workflows.

By implementing and maintaining effective automation solutions, we help you save time and achieve consistent, high-quality results.

  • Performance Testing

Performance testing ensures software can handle varyinPerformance testing ensures that software remains scalable and responsive under varying loads. Without it, bottlenecks can lead to poor user experiences and operational inefficiencies.

By conducting load and stress tests, we identify potential performance issues and optimize systems for real-world demands. This ensures seamless operation and user satisfaction.

We ensure your software performs reliably, meeting both user expectations and business needs, even under high demand.

Need help?

Not sure where to start or have questions about your software testing needs? We’re here to help. Whether you’re looking for advice, solutions, or just a conversation, feel free to reach out.

Let’s work together to ensure your software meets the highest standards of quality. Contact us today—no strings attached!